Broker's Comments

The Cape Cutter is a direct competitor for the better known and ever popular Cornish Shrimper. Under full main & genoa she is much quicker & livelier than many yachts in her size range - but once you tuck a reef in the main & set the working jib, she becomes a tough and brave little yacht designed to get you home safely. Ideal weekend cruiser for couples & families, which can also be sailed single handed. Handy enough with its custom designed trailer to be trailer sailed regularly. She's pretty, sails well & has enough charm for all but the most died in the wool traditionalist.
